Sample Answer
Indeed, I believe that large companies have an inherent responsibility to be socially accountable. Given their vast resources and significant influence on the economy and society, these organizations possess the capacity to enact positive change. For instance, they can promote sustainable practices by reducing their carbon footprint or investing in renewable energy sources, thereby contributing to environmental preservation.
Moreover, large corporations often benefit from the communities in which they operate; thus, it is only equitable for them to give back through philanthropy, fair labor practices, and supporting local initiatives. Additionally, in an age where consumers are increasingly aware and concerned about ethical considerations, social responsibility has evolved into a vital component of corporate reputation. Companies that prioritize ethical behavior often enjoy enhanced loyalty and trust from their clientele, ultimately improving their business viability in the long run.
